Ralph M. Knight Chemistry & Engineering Scholarship
$5,000
In 2010, Mrs. Nancy Knight established the Ralph M. Knight Chemistry and Engineering Scholarship in honor of her late husband, Ralph, a chemical engineer. The Knight family aims to continue his legacy by assisting others in making significant contributions to society.Who Can Apply:Applicants for the Ralph M. Knight Chemistry and Engineering Scholarship must be full-time seniors enrolled in a Catholic high school within the Phoenix Diocese. They must also be practicing Catholics who are either U.S. citizens or permanent residents. Society of Tribologists and Lubrication Engineers Scholarships
$5,500
The STLE Presidential Awards Program offers three distinct academic awards: The E. Richard Booser Scholarship for undergraduate students, The Elmer E. Klaus Fellowship for graduate students, and The Jeanie S. McCoy Scholarship for female students. These awards, managed by the STLE Presidential Council, aim to inspire students to seek advanced degrees or careers in tribology or lubrication engineering by funding a related research project. Overseas Press Club Foundation Scholarships
$4,000
The Overseas Press Club Foundation Scholar Awards are open to undergraduate and graduate students from North American institutions or American students studying overseas. To be eligible, applicants must be enrolled in a degree program as a junior, senior, or graduate student at the time of application and have shown an interest in international journalism. Each year, the Foundation typically awards 18 scholarships to support academic pursuits.
